With over 14+ years of experience in Quality Assurance, I have expertise in ETL/Data warehouse backend testing, BI Intelligence reports, and AWS cloud Data Testing. I excel in coordinating QA testing teams and collaborating with scrum team members, business stakeholders, and solution architects to ensure comprehensive project scope execution from a testing perspective. My skills and experience make me adept at understanding and implementing the requirements of stories, change requests, and incident tasks. I am committed to delivering high-quality results and contributing to the success of projects.
Overview
14
14
years of professional experience
1
1
Certification
Work History
Senior QA Automation Engineer
Transition Technologies MS
Selangor
08.2021 - Current
Client: Roche Malaysia; Role: Test Coordinator / Lead.
Co ordinating QA testing Team and working closely with scrum team members, Business stakeholders and solution architects to understand the project scope
Good experience in working with Agile methodology (Scrum, Kanban). Currently working on Scrum.
Responsible for Finalizing the Testing Scope based on the story /Change Request / Incident Task
Responsible for co ordinating a team and resolving issues / obstacles with Iteration task/allocation/testing
Responsible for Creating automation test strategy /Test suite to create /review and execute complex SQL script through pyspark framework and review python scripts to verify and validate data across multiple stages / layers within AWS
Responsible for validating the Customer Master data (MDM) received from IQVIA and validate from sftp and processed through various layers in data hub and flow through various downstream including salesforce
Creating Athena automation test suite to validate certain layers of data in AWS where data stored on athena tables
Responsible for validating the Initial and Incremental data loads to ensure the data quality, Integrity and latency has been met as per the requirement and ETL Mapping documents
Responsible for data quality, such as file validation, data validation, business rules validation between the source and target systems, golden record validation, functional validation, and audit tables or flat files validation.
Responsible for system testing, integration E2E testing, and regression testing using an automation framework to validate across stages in AWS.
Participate in Agile ceremonies (PI Planning, Daily Scrum, Sprint Review, Sprint Backlog Refinement, and Retrospective).
Software Quality Assurance Engineer
AETINS sdn bhd
Selangor
07.2020 - 10.2020
Client: Sun Life Malaysia; Role: UAT Test Coordinator.
Worked in an Agile (SCRUM) methodology.
Worked in the insurance domain on validating the proposal form, sales illustration, and customer fact find.
Coordinating with different teams as part of UAT validation, such as the Pricing Team, Product Team, and Underwriting Team.
Validating the sales data before production deployment.
Client/Stakeholder Management and Issue Resolution.
Planned test schedules in accordance with project scope and delivery deadlines.
Interacted with customers and internal stakeholders to ensure a complete and thorough understanding of all requirements.
Senior ETL Tester
Accionlabs Sdn Bhd
Selangor
09.2016 - 06.2020
Client: Nielsen Malaysia, Role: Senior ETL Test Engineer.
Worked as an individual contributor and SPOC in the testing environment.
Developed ETL test scripts based on technical specifications, data design documents, and source-to-target mappings.
Extensively tested several Business Objects reports and dashboards to validate the reports, the data, and the cosmetics of the report.
Performed count validation, dimensional analysis, statistical analysis, and data quality validation as per data mapping in data migration.
Validate the full load and delta load in the Staging DB, and perform data validation.
Involved in loading data into the target system, where I identify the gap between the source data and the loaded data in the target.
Worked on the production data migration activity for moving the data into the cloud environment.
Data handling on a big scale and managing to handle data from different countries at the same time.
Developed complex SQL queries for querying data against different databases for the data verification process.
Spool data from tables into files as part of post-validation of loading and verifying the data sync.
Tested a number of complex ETL mappings, and reusable transformations for daily data loads.
Client/Stakeholder Management and Issue Resolution.
Planned and strategized test schedules in accordance with project scope and delivery deadlines.
Worked on issues with the migration of data from the development to the QA test environment.
Interacted with customers and internal stakeholders to ensure a complete and thorough understanding of all requirements.
Test Analyst
Infosys Technologies ltd
Bangalore
12.2008 - 11.2016
Client Best Buy Europe- Infosys iEngage Apparel and Infosys Telco Platform
Designed the test scenarios as per the business requirements and mapping documents.
Profiling the data using Talend and PostgreSQL.
Responsible for verifying the data movement between Talend and the database server, and verifying that the data has been pushed to the respective Datamart schema by using PostgreSQL.
Validation rules, as per the requirements in different cases,
Acquired knowledge in complex SQL scenarios.
Involved in end to end testing and in different stages of the project Understand the transformation rules and create test cases based on the business requirement
Involved in generating various reports from pentaho tool
Involved in FTP processing the test data file in the local servers using PUTTY(unix commands) and File zilla
Reporting the defects using TFS Bug Validation and setting a defect triage call with the development and BA leads for bug validation
Worked independently as a single point of contact from the testing team for Web Analytics testing using the Insight Infosys tool.
Involved in batch testing and real-time integration testing.
Involved in customizing the website using the Hybris management console.
Preparing and sharing various status reports, which include the daily status report, defect report, test completion report, and project sign-off report, to all the project stakeholders.